'Shudra' definitions:

Definition of 'Shudra'

(from WordNet)
noun
A member of the lowest or worker Hindu caste [syn: Shudra, Sudra]
noun
The lowest of the four varnas: the servants and workers of low status [syn: sudra, shudra]